Position Summary

The Shelter Support Advocate plays a key role in providing direct support and advocacy for guests at GFHA's low-barrier emergency shelter. This position supports individuals experiencing homelessness—many of whom may also be navigating mental health challenges, substance use, or trauma—using a Housing First and Harm Reduction approach.

Under the direction of the Shelter Program Coordinator and Client Services Director, Shelter Support Advocates ensure a safe, welcoming, and respectful environment for all guests while maintaining shelter operations and connecting clients to community resources.

Key Responsibilities

  • Foster a safe, supportive, and inclusive environment for all shelter guests in alignment with Housing First and Harm Reduction principles.
  • Conduct guest intake, check-in, and bed assignments, assessing for safety and immediate needs.
  • Provide guests with essential items such as food, toiletries, and bedding.
  • De-escalate and manage crisis situations using trauma-informed, empathetic, and nonjudgmental communication techniques.
  • Monitor shelter activities, maintain order, and promote adherence to shelter rules and policies.
  • Maintain accurate and confidential HMIS data, daily logs, incident reports, and communication records in compliance with HIPAA and CFR 42 regulations.
  • Build supportive relationships with guests by assisting with problem-solving, goal setting, and referrals to appropriate services.
  • Coordinate and communicate with community partners, including law enforcement, healthcare providers, and outreach workers.
  • Maintain knowledge of local resources for housing, substance use treatment, and mental health support.
  • Assist with facility cleanliness and safety checks.
  • Participate in ongoing training related to trauma-informed care, harm reduction, de-escalation, and motivational interviewing.
  • Perform other related duties as assigned.

Skills and Abilities

  • Strong crisis intervention and de-escalation skills.
  • Ability to maintain calm and professionalism in challenging or emotionally charged situations.
  • Demonstrated empathy, patience, and respect for individuals from diverse backgrounds and life experiences.
  • Working knowledge of Housing First, Harm Reduction, and trauma-informed care models.
  • Proficient written and verbal communication skills.
  • Strong organizational and documentation abilities.
  • Ability to maintain confidentiality and uphold ethical standards.
  • Basic computer literacy and comfort with data entry systems (HMIS experience preferred).

Preferred Qualifications

  • High school diploma or GED required; Associate degree in human services or related field preferred.
  • Two years of experience working in social services, housing, or a shelter environment.
  • Experience working with individuals experiencing homelessness, mental illness, or substance use strongly preferred.
  • Valid driver's license and reliable transportation required.
  • Must pass all applicable background checks, including criminal records screening.

Working Conditions

  • Shelter operates 24/7; shifts may include days (8:00am–4:30pm), evenings (4:00pm–12:30am), or overnights (12:00am–8:30am).
  • Work is performed in both office and shelter environments.
  • Physical activity includes mobility throughout the facility and occasional lifting of supplies or light furniture.
